Barberousse Red Ale is a characterful specialty beer from Switzerland, boasting an alcohol content of 5.5% by volume. This Red Ale offers a harmonious balance between sweet and bitter notes that are noticeable from the very first sip. The moderate bitterness, measured at 15 International Bitterness Units (IBU), complements the sweet aromas and provides a pleasant tasting experience. Ideal for social occasions or relaxed evenings, this beer reveals its full flavor at a drinking temperature of 9 to 10 degrees Celsius. The appealing color and full-bodied taste make Barberousse Red Ale an excellent choice for specialty beer enthusiasts.

  • Harmonious balance between sweetness and bitterness
  • Moderate bitterness with 15 IBU
  • Recommended drinking temperature of 9 to 10 degrees Celsius.
